Connect YouTube

Connecting your YouTube channel lets the app read how your videos actually performed and feed that back into what it makes next.

Connecting

01Open the channel, go to Settings → YouTube (or the Connect YouTube screen).
02Press Connect and complete Google’s consent screen.
03Wait for the first sync — it pulls your recent videos and their statistics.

What it can and cannot do

The connection is read-only analytics. It reads your videos and their performance; it does not upload for you. When you publish a video yourself, the next sync matches it to the one produced here and its statistics start appearing in analytics.

Disconnecting stops the sync and removes access. Your videos and assets in this app are unaffected.

After connecting

The channel’s Analytics tab and the Connect YouTube screen show views, click-through rate, retention and per-video breakdowns, over a selectable window such as the last 28 days.
